After flying high against Cheltenham last Monday, Upper Dublin came back down to earth. The Upper Dublin Cardinals fell just short of the New Hope-Solebury Lions by a score of 4-2 on Wednesday. Upper Dublin was given a dose of their own medicine in this game as New Hope-Solebury apparently hadn't forgotten their loss the last time these teams played back in May of 2023.
Kyla Garrison spent all seven innings on the mound, and it's clear why: she surrendered only one earned (and three unearned) runs on five hits and racked up nine Ks. She has been nothing but reliable: she hasn't tossed less than seven strikeouts every time she's pitched this season.
On the hitting side, Upper Dublin saw five different players step up and record at least one hit. One of them was Kate Brannigan, who scored a run and stole a base while going 2-for-3.
Upper Dublin's defeat dropped their record down to 7-6. As for New Hope-Solebury, their victory ended an eight-game drought at home dating back to last season and bumped them up to 4-2.
Upper Dublin will take on Lower Moreland at 3:45 p.m. on Friday. Upper Dublin is strutting in with some hitting muscle, as they've averaged 6.3 runs per game this season. As for New Hope-Solebury, they will head out on the road to face off against Quakertown at 3:45 p.m. on Friday. Quakertown will roll in looking for their 12th straight win, something New Hope-Solebury surely won't give up without a fight.
Article generated by infoSentience based on data entered on MaxPreps